Handmade on the Rue St. Honore in Paris, these 18th-century inspired ceramics are crafted in a traditional pottery style passed down from generations. Hand molded from black terracotta, each piece is finished in a milky-white glaze that highlights the unique character of the clay, celebrating its imperfections and ensuring that no two pieces are exactly alike. Romantically bohemian, yet practical for every day utilize, they are entirely handcrafted in an antique Bastille workshop, historically home to Napoleon Bonaparte’s own silversmith.
Dimensions: 6.25″ W x 4.75″ H Brand: Astier de Villatte Category: Kitchen + Dining Sub-Category: Drinkware Serveware Care: Dishwasher secure when using a moderate wash cycle between 110 and 130 degrees Fahrenheit; use phosphate-free dishwashing tablets; not microwave or oven harmless. Material: Black Terracotta clay with white enameled glaze
